Kitchen remodeling costs rely on your specific goals and the condition of your current space. Choosing high-end materials like custom cabinetry, stone countertops, or professional-grade appliances will increase the budget. The scope of work is another major factor; moving plumbing or gas lines, changing the room layout, or expanding the footprint requires more labor and permits compared to a simple cosmetic update. Keeping your existing floor plan is the most effective way to manage expenses. Whether you are planning a modest refresh or a complete teardown, it helps to identify your priorities early. The cost of quartz countertops in Washington D.C. is primarily driven by the slab's origin, brand, and specific design. Factors like the quartz-to-resin ratio, edge detailing such as a bullnose or eased edge, and the overall thickness of the slab directly impact the material's price point. Complex fabrication, such as intricate cutouts for sinks or specialized edge treatments, will also increase the overall cost. The complexity of the installation, including any necessary sub-base preparation or removal of existing materials, further contributes to the final quote. The installation of kitchen cabinets in Washington D.C. begins with a thorough site assessment to confirm precise measurements and identify any structural considerations. Following the approval of the design and material specifications, the custom or pre-fabricated cabinets are ordered. Upon delivery, the licensed installation crew will carefully position and secure each cabinet unit, ensuring proper alignment and structural integrity. This phase includes the installation of hardware, such as hinges and drawer slides, followed by any necessary trim work or finishing touches. Cambria quartz countertops offer significant advantages for kitchens in Washington D.C., renowned for their non-porous surface that resists staining and bacteria, a critical feature in busy households. Their superior durability means they are highly resistant to scratches and chips, maintaining their pristine appearance over time. Furthermore, Cambria is NSF 400 certified for food safety, providing peace of mind for home cooks. Their low maintenance requirements also appeal to homeowners seeking convenience.

Modern kitchen design trends in Washington D.C. are leaning towards minimalist aesthetics, integrated smart technology, and sustainable materials. Clean lines, handleless cabinetry, and a focus on natural light are prevalent. Matte finishes on cabinetry and countertops, particularly in neutral tones like grays, whites, and subtle earth tones, are popular. Integrated appliances that blend seamlessly with cabinetry contribute to a streamlined look. Open shelving for displaying curated items and the incorporation of natural elements like wood or stone accents are also key features defining contemporary kitchen spaces.

Solid surface countertops offer several benefits for homeowners in Washington D.C., including their non-porous nature, which makes them highly resistant to stains and bacterial growth, promoting a hygienic kitchen environment. They are also repairable; minor scratches or chips can often be sanded out, restoring the surface's original appearance. They are also available in a vast array of colors and patterns, offering significant design flexibility. Their durability and ease of maintenance make them a practical choice.
